Simple Strategy for Avoiding Tweaks

This article discusses the simple strategy for avoiding tweaks when developing projects. Following these eight steps, you can complete your projects on time and with fewer errors

Every developer knows that when they start a project, they have a certain amount of time to complete it. However, as the project progresses, the number of changes and tweaks needed to make the project perfect can add up.

The last thing developers want is to spend more time on the project than they need to or to make mistakes that cause further delays.

To avoid these problems, developers must devise a strategy for avoiding tweaks. Here, we will be discussing a simple strategy for avoiding tweaks that can help you complete your projects on time and with fewer errors.

Step 1: Make Sure You Have a Clear Plan

The first step in avoiding tweaks is to make sure that you have a clear plan. This means sitting down and figuring out your goals for the project.

What do you want the project to accomplish? Who is your target audience? What are the specs that you must meet? Answering these questions will help you to define your scope and set realistic goals.

Once you have your goals in mind, you can then start planning your development process. Lay out a roadmap that includes milestones, timelines, and deadlines for each step of the process.

This will create a roadmap that is clear and transparent so everyone knows the next steps and how you are progressing.

Step 2: Plan for Changes

One of the reasons developers make tweaks is because they don’t anticipate changes that may occur. Changes can happen for many reasons (shifts in user preferences, new regulations, etc.), so it’s better to be proactive and plan for them.

When planning, be sure to build in contingencies in case changes happen. For example, build in additional time to the project timeline to accommodate changes, and create a way to document and track any changes that occur.

This will help you keep track of what changes you’ve made and why you’ve made them, as well as provide a record for future reference – such as if there’s a comparable feature in another project – or potential objections.

Step 3: Prioritize Your Goals

Another reason developers make tweaks is because they have too many goals or objectives that aren’t prioritized – which can add up to unnecessary or simplistic edits or changes.

To avoid this, prioritize the goals you set during the planning process. Prioritize based on what delivers the most impact, urgency, or what affects the end goal the most.

By doing this, you can accurately assess the level of importance of each component. That way, if you need to cut something out, you’ll know that the most critical elements or features were made while modifying or eliminating minor tweaks.

Step 4: Stick to the Plan

Once you have your plan in place, the biggest thing developers can do to avoid tweaks is sticking to the plan. This means not deviating from the plan you have created. In many cases, sticking to the plan will force you to focus on the essentials.

The more focused you are on what you need to do, the less room you will have to create tweaks that aren’t essential to the project’s success.

That being said, staying within the parameters isn’t always easy. In some cases, external forces – such as changes in technology – may mean you have to make adjustments.

However, if there are no concrete reasons for changes and the project stays on track, it’s best to adhere to your plan.

Related Article Effortless Tip for Staying on Track Effortless Tip for Staying on Track

Step 5: Get Feedback Early

One way to avoid making too many changes is to get feedback early on in the development process. The sooner you get feedback, the sooner you can make corrections.

This can be an early assurance that the project is on the right track and can reveal any problems while they are still small and manageable. The sooner the feedback is received, the more likely you will make in-course corrections that make developing and delivery easier.

On the other hand, if you wait too long to get feedback, you’ll end up making more significant tweaks or changes, and it could lead to more wasted time and resources.

So, try to incorporate feedback as soon as possible and stick to the original plan where possible but if there are problems, don’t hesitate to adjust the development process flow.

Step 6: Test, Test, Test

One of the critical things to remember when you’re trying to avoid tweaking your development project is to test your work.

Testing is an excellent tool to ensure that your project works correctly and has all the features that you and your team agreed upon in the planning process. By testing the project multiple times, you can make sure that it’s running smoothly and that everything is working as it should.

Testing can also help you identify problems and issues with the project. Even if the problems are minor, you can correct them early in the process – which ensures the final product is better and meets all customers’ needs and expectations.

Step 7: Communicate Effectively

A crucial part of avoiding tweaks is communication.

By communicating effectively with all stakeholders, you can make sure everyone is on the same page, working in a congruent manner, and aware of all your expectations, deadlines, and changes in the project.

Communication is also necessary for feedback gathering and prioritizing goals.

Your communication strategy should include clear reporting and documentation, so changes are cataloged, and regular updates so everyone is kept up to speed on project status.

Step 8: Focus on Delivering Value

Ultimately, the best way to avoid tweaks is to focus on delivering value. If you successfully deliver value to your customers or stakeholders, the likelihood of tweaking will diminish.

When developing your project, focus on what your target audience really needs from your project and make that your priority.

By focusing on delivering value, you can minimize the time wasted on tweaks that don’t add value and maximize the time and resources spent on features that make your project a success.

Conclusion

Following this simple strategy for avoiding tweaks will help you be more efficient and effective in your development projects.

By creating a clear plan, prioritizing goals, soliciting feedback soon, and focusing on delivering value, you can minimize the number of tweaks you need to make and have a successful project that is completed on time and delivers value to your clients, customers, or stakeholders.
